Worth noting
• Right-hander John Lackey (strained right bicep) started his throwing program on Tuesday, playing catch at 120 feet. Farrell said that Lackey was more aggressive than expected, a sign of how strong he is feeling.
• Lefty Franklin Morales (lower back strain) will start for Class A Greenville on Wednesday, opening his Minor League rehab assignment. Morales is being stretched out as a starter during his rehab to give the Red Sox options in case a starting pitcher goes down.
• Backup catcher David Ross got the nod over Jarrod Saltalamacchia for Tuesday's game against the Indians.
"Again, just to keep [David] involved," said Farrell. "We know with [Justin] Masterson tomorrow, with [Zach] McAllister on Thursday, Salty will be right back in there. This is a matter of just keeping a little bit of a rotation going."
